Emergency Oxygen Equipment and Supplies Policy Clarification (IB24-41)

Date: 10/31/24

Louisiana Healthcare Connecitons is sharing Emergency Oxygen Equipment and Supplies Policy Clarification (IB24-41)External Link provided on October 29, 2024.

Louisiana Medicaid updated the Durable Medical Equipment (DME) Provider Manual to clarify DME provider responsibilities related to access to oxygen equipment and supplies during an official state and/or federally declared emergency. The updates to Section 18.1 Services and Limitations and Section 18.4 Provider Responsibilities are located on www.lamedicaid.comExternal Link.

The changes are outlined below:

  • Medically necessary backup oxygen and equipment provided during an official state and/or federally declared emergency cannot be considered non-covered.
  • Backup oxygen and equipment provided outside an official state and/or federally declared emergency is non-covered.
  • Providers are responsible for ensuring that medical oxygen and oxygen-related equipment are available during official state and/or federally declared emergencies, if medically necessary. 
  • The Department will not reimburse providers for unused equipment and supplies picked up after an emergency.
